Crash-and-grab thieves take ATM during late night run to the liquor store
"Dude, we're out of beer... and cash."
Ok, so maybe they didn't steal any beer, but the latest in a string of crash-and-grab robberies occurred early Tuesday morning in a Dallas neighborhood. The thieves crashed an automobile through the front of the Cork and Bottle, a liquor store on Greenville and Mockingbird, and stole the location's ATM machine.
